Choosing the Right Toyota Highlander Catalytic Converter: Key Factors to Consider
Fitment and Compatibility
Correct fitment is the single most important factor because the converter must mate with the Highlander exhaust flange geometry and sensor locations.
A unit that matches the vehicle-specific inlet and outlet diameters, flange type, and oxygen sensor ports reduces the need for modifications and lowers risk of leaks. Poor fitment can lead to exhaust leaks, rattles, or sensor errors that trigger warning lights. Always verify vehicle year and engine variant alignment when assessing compatibility to avoid installation headaches.
Emissions Conversion Efficiency
Conversion efficiency determines how well the catalyst reduces hydrocarbons, carbon monoxide, and NOx from exhaust gases.
Higher-efficiency substrates and optimized washcoats convert a larger portion of pollutants, which is important for passing emissions testing and reducing environmental impact. Look for information on substrate cell density and washcoat technology, as these influence light-off characteristics and sustained conversion under real driving conditions.
Durability and Construction
Durable construction extends service life and prevents costly premature failures.
Key aspects include corrosion-resistant shells, robust internal supports to prevent substrate breakage, and welded or properly flanged joints. Materials and build quality affect resistance to road salt and thermal cycling. A converter that resists cracking and external corrosion will maintain performance and fitment longer.
Sensor Integration and OBD Compatibility
Modern vehicles rely on oxygen sensors and onboard diagnostics to monitor converter performance.
A converter that provides correct oxygen sensor bung placement and preserves OBD-II monitoring behavior reduces the chance of check engine light catalytic converter issues. Proper sensor integration helps the vehicle achieve accurate post-catalyst readings and avoids false fault codes or driveability problems.
Installation Requirements and Serviceability
Installation complexity affects time, tools needed, and whether a professional is required.
Bolt-on units that match factory flanges are typically straightforward, while converters that require cutting, adaptors, or welding increase labor and potential for errors. Consider whether replacement will require other exhaust part removal, access to oxygen sensors, or special hardware. Ease of future service, such as accessible sensor ports, also matters.
Regulatory and Emissions Certifications
Certifications and emissions documentation indicate a converter meets regulatory standards for emissions control.
Units with clear emissions compliance information are more likely to pass inspection and testing. Check for applicable environmental approvals or documented test results when available. Lack of certification does not always mean poor performance, but documented compliance reduces uncertainty and simplifies registration in regions with emissions testing.
FAQ
How do I know if my Toyota Highlander catalytic converter is failing?
Signs often include diminished engine performance, a noticeable decrease in fuel economy, and unusual exhaust odors. You may also see the check engine light catalytic converter–related codes or experience louder exhaust noise from a damaged substrate. These catalytic converter failure signs usually prompt diagnostic scanning and visual inspection to confirm.
Will a faulty catalytic converter trigger the check engine light?
Yes, catalytic converter issues frequently cause the check engine light to illuminate. The vehicle computer monitors post-catalyst oxygen sensor readings and compares them to expected values. If readings indicate poor conversion or damage, the system often stores fault codes related to catalytic efficiency and emissions, which you can diagnose with a scanner.
Can I replace the catalytic converter myself?
How to replace catalytic converter tasks vary in difficulty depending on whether the unit is bolt-on or requires cutting and welding. Some mechanically inclined owners can perform bolt-on replacements with standard tools, while others prefer a professional for units requiring exhaust modifications. Proper sensor handling and sealing are important to avoid leaks and faults.
Does a new catalytic converter affect exhaust emissions and performance?
Generally, a properly functioning converter improves exhaust emissions by reducing pollutants and can restore smooth engine operation if the old unit was clogged or damaged. Restored exhaust flow may also normalize engine management behavior. However, actual performance changes depend on the vehicle condition and the specific issue being addressed.
What should I check before buying a replacement converter for a Highlander?
Confirm exact model year and engine or drivetrain specifications to ensure CAT converter fitment. Verify oxygen sensor port locations and flange styles match the vehicle. Also review construction details for corrosion resistance and whether the unit includes necessary hardware or adapters for installation.
